JackChen 38a88df144 feat: add customTools support to AgentConfig for orchestrator-level tool injection
Users can now pass custom ToolDefinition objects via AgentConfig.customTools,
which are registered alongside built-in tools in all orchestrator paths
(runAgent, runTeam, runTasks). Custom tools bypass allowlist/preset filtering
but can still be blocked by disallowedTools.

JackChen 9a446b8796 fix: propagate error events in AgentRunner.run() (#98)
run() only handled 'done' events from stream(), silently dropping
'error' events. This caused failed LLM calls to return an empty
RunResult that the caller treated as successful.

JackChen 03dc897929 fix: eliminate duplicate progress events and double completedTaskCount in short-circuit path (#82)
The short-circuit block in runTeam() called this.runAgent(), which emits
its own agent_start/agent_complete events and increments completedTaskCount.
The short-circuit block then emitted the same events again, and
buildTeamRunResult() incremented the count a second time.

Fix: call buildAgent() + agent.run() directly, bypassing runAgent().
Events and counting are handled once by the short-circuit block and
buildTeamRunResult() respectively.

EchoOfZion cfbbd24601 feat: skip coordinator for simple goals in runTeam()
When a goal is short (<200 chars) and contains no multi-step or
coordination signals, runTeam() now dispatches directly to the
best-matching agent — skipping the coordinator decomposition and
synthesis round-trips. This saves ~2 LLM calls worth of tokens
and latency for genuinely simple goals.

Complexity detection uses regex patterns for sequencing markers
(first...then, step N, numbered lists), coordination language
(collaborate, coordinate, work together), parallel execution
signals, and multi-deliverable patterns.

Agent selection reuses the same keyword-affinity scoring as the
capability-match scheduler strategy to pick the most relevant
agent from the team roster.

- Add isSimpleGoal() and selectBestAgent() (exported for testing)
- Add 35 unit tests covering heuristic edge cases and integration
- Update existing runTeam tests to use complex goals
